#bdbcf6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bdbcf6 is composed of 74.1% red, 73.7%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.2% cyan, 23.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 241 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 85.1%. #bdbcf6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7b79ed.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#bdbcf6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bdbcf6 has RGB values of R:189, G:188, B:246 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 12434678.

							Shades and Tints of #bdbcf6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f0f0fd is the lightest one.
